Responsibilities:
- Open and process new title files efficiently and accurately
- Perform title examinations and work to clear any title issues
- Identify and resolve potential file concerns proactively
- Provide expert guidance and support to clients throughout the transaction
- Draft all required settlement documentation
- Prepare and balance Closing Disclosures (CDs) and settlement statements
- Coordinate and schedule closings with clients, agents, and lenders
- Maintain accurate records and ensure timely processing of all documentation
- Manage post-closing processes including document recording and policy issuance
- Collaborate with lenders, realtors, and clients to ensure seamless communication and service from start to finish
